Introduction

Binary options trading involves predicting the price movement of assets within a specific period. Using multiple oscillators in a strategy can help traders identify overbought and oversold conditions more clearly. Oscillators such as the Relative Strength Index (RSI), Stochastic Oscillator, and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) are popular in technical analysis. This article explains how to combine these tools for improved trading decisions.

Understanding Multiple Oscillators

Oscillators are technical indicators that measure momentum, and each oscillator works in its own way. When using multiple oscillators, traders attempt to find confirmation signals that can reduce potential false signals. Key internal references related to this topic include:

The strategy focuses on exploiting the convergence and divergence of signals provided by these indicators.

Below is a comparative table of popular oscillators used in binary options strategies:

Oscillator Key Function Signal Range Common Application
RSI Measures strength and speed of price movements 0 to 100 Identifying overbought/oversold conditions
Stochastic Oscillator Compares closing price to price range over a period 0 to 100 Spotting turning points in trends
MACD Shows the relationship between two moving averages Varies Detecting trend reversals

Practical Examples from IQ Option and Pocket Option

Many traders on platforms such as IQ Option and Pocket Option have successfully applied the multiple oscillators strategy. For instance, a trader might observe the following conditions: 1. The RSI indicates that the market is oversold (below 30). 2. The Stochastic Oscillator confirms the oversold condition with both %K and %D lines below 20. 3. The MACD histogram starts to show a positive divergence, indicating an impending reversal.

When these three oscillators align, a binary options trader might decide to place a "call" option, expecting the asset price to rise within the specified time.
